SSL证书能防数据窃取吗?

时间 : 2025-07-01 20:38:04浏览量 : 68

在当今数字化的时代,数据安全至关重要。随着互联网的广泛应用,用户在网上传输的各种信息,如个人身份信息、财务数据等,都面临着被窃取的风险。而 SSL 证书作为一种加密技术,被广泛应用于网站上,以保障数据的安全传输。那么,SSL 证书到底能否有效地防止数据窃取呢?

SSL 证书的全称是“Secure Sockets Layer Certificate”,即安全套接层证书。它通过在客户端和服务器之间建立一个加密的连接,确保数据在传输过程中不被窃取、篡改或伪造。当用户访问一个使用了 SSL 证书的网站时,浏览器会与服务器进行握手协商,建立起一个安全的连接。在这个连接过程中,数据会被加密,只有客户端和服务器能够解密和读取数据,而第三方无法获取到数据的内容。

SSL 证书的加密技术主要基于公钥加密和对称加密两种方式。公钥加密用于在客户端和服务器之间交换加密密钥,对称加密则用于对实际传输的数据进行加密。通过这种方式,即使数据在网络中被截获,也无法被解密,从而保证了数据的安全性。

SSL 证书还可以通过数字证书认证机构(CA)的验证来确保网站的真实性和可信度。CA 会对网站的身份进行验证,颁发数字证书,并将证书的公钥公布在可信的证书颁发机构列表中。当用户访问一个网站时,浏览器会验证该网站的数字证书是否合法,以及证书的公钥是否与网站的实际公钥一致。如果验证通过,浏览器会认为该网站是安全的,可以放心地与服务器进行数据传输。

然而,需要注意的是,SSL 证书并不能完全防止数据窃取。虽然它可以加密数据传输,但如果网站本身存在漏洞或安全问题,攻击者仍然可以通过其他途径获取数据。例如,网站可能存在 SQL 注入漏洞、跨站脚本攻击(XSS)漏洞等,这些漏洞可以让攻击者绕过 SSL 证书的加密机制,直接访问和窃取数据库中的数据。

SSL 证书的安全性也取决于其配置和使用情况。如果证书的配置不当,或者使用了过期或不安全的证书,也会降低数据的安全性。因此,网站管理员需要正确配置 SSL 证书,及时更新证书,并遵循安全最佳实践,以确保 SSL 证书的有效性和安全性。

综上所述,SSL 证书可以在一定程度上防止数据窃取。它通过加密数据传输和验证网站的真实性,为用户提供了一个相对安全的网络环境。然而,SSL 证书并不能完全消除数据窃取的风险,网站管理员和用户都需要共同努力,采取其他安全措施,如加强网站的安全防护、定期备份数据等,以保障数据的安全。在选择网站时,用户也应该注意查看网站是否使用了有效的 SSL 证书,以确保自己的信息安全。